Ticket: Staging env misconfigured for Siftgate bloom filter

The bloom layer in front of the Pellet KV store is rejecting all lookups in staging because the env file was copied from the dev template without credentials. False-positive tuning values are fine; only the auth line is missing. To unblock the weekly demo, the Pellet admission secret must be set on the following line.

env line for yaguf-fajop: LEDGER_TOKEN13=fb08984397349

Handover — Vexler partner SFTP drop

Ownership moves to you today. Drop runs hourly from Vexler's end into the intake bucket via the relay host. Watch for zero-byte files; their exporter flakes on Mondays. Creds live in the ops vault, path noted in the runbook. Vault auto-seals after 48h idle. Support escalations go to the on-call rotation, not me. If the vault is sealed when you need it, unseal with the recovery passphrase below.

recovery phrase for tadug-fafof: zorwyn-kasion

## 2.8.0 — Setting renamed in tailwisp CLI

The log-tailing credential setting formerly read from STREAM_KEY has been renamed to avoid a collision with the Bramblecourt metrics exporter, which consumed the same variable and caused intermittent auth failures on shared runners. The old name is now ignored entirely; there is no fallback, by design, so stale configs fail loudly rather than half-working. Release managers should update every runner's env file before promoting 2.8.0. The renamed setting and its secret belong on the line that follows.

sealed setting: ARCHIVE_KEY3=8d0